Springboot
作为工程选型技术的时候,由于其三大特性的自动装配,使得我们把注意力更多的放在功能代码实现上,同时也对代码的编写质量提出了更高的要求,这里所说的质量,说的是编码规范。接下来的我会分为三个步骤去了解整个编码基础构建的要点,Controller
统一返回、Controller
请求AOP日志管理、Controller
统一异常处理。为什么需要统一返回数据?如果你和你的同时合作过,他来开发后端接口,你来开发前端界面,我想在交互的时候,你会有多么期待统一返回,这会让你的请求变得无比得清秀。下面是一些非统一返回得实例:
@RestController@RequestMapping("example")public class ExampleController { @GetMapping("str") public String str() { return "Result Type is String"; } @GetMapping("map") @ResponseBody public Mapmap() { Map hashMap = new HashMap<>(1); hashMap.put("Result", "Map"); return hashMap; } @PostMapping("none") public void none() { System.out.println("none"); }}
无论是什么请求,后端人员要是按照自己得喜好或者便利去返回对应得数据,对于前端得请求来说是灾难性得,对前端来说相当不友好。
下面是统一返回实力:
@RestController@RequestMapping("gua")public class GuaController { @GetMapping("str") public ResponseData str() { return ResponseDataUtil.buildSuccess("Result String"); } @GetMapping("data") public ResponseData data() { return ResponseDataUtil.buildSuccess(new User()); } @GetMapping("map") public ResponseData map() { HashMapmap = new HashMap<>(1); map.put("Result", "Map"); return ResponseDataUtil.buildSuccess(map); }}
结果:
{"code":"0000","msg":"Result String","data":null}{"code":"0000","msg":"请求成功","data":{"name":"DongGua","age":18}}{"code":"0000","msg":"请求成功","data":{"Result":"Map"}}
前端童鞋可以通过code得约定来处理结果。同样得后端同学也可一写出更加简洁易懂得代码。
ResponseData
作为统一返回得实体,由ResponseData
作为容器把消息返回。其结构也超级简单,需要三个组件: ResponseData
ResponseDataUtils
ResultEnum
下面分别给出其结构:
ResponseData
public class ResponseDataimplements Serializable { private String code; private String msg; private T data; public ResponseData(String code, String msg, T data) { this.code = code; this.msg = msg; this.data = data; } public ResponseData(String code, String msg) { this.code = code; this.msg = msg; } public ResponseData(ResultEnums resultEnums) { this.code = resultEnums.getCode(); this.msg = resultEnums.getMsg(); } public ResponseData(ResultEnums resultEnums, T data) { this.code = resultEnums.getCode(); this.msg = resultEnums.getMsg(); this.data = data; } public ResponseData() { } public String getCode() { return code; } public void setCode(String code) { this.code = code; } public String getMsg() { return msg; } public void setMsg(String msg) { this.msg = msg; } public T getData() { return data; } public void setData(T data) { this.data = data; }}
ResponsDataUtils
public class ResponseDataUtil { /** * 带实体的统一返回 * * @param data 实体 * @param实体类型 * @return */ public static ResponseData buildSuccess(T data) { return new ResponseData (ResultEnums.SUCCESS, data); } public static ResponseData buildSuccess() { return new ResponseData(ResultEnums.SUCCESS); } public static ResponseData buildSuccess(String msg) { return new ResponseData(ResultEnums.SUCCESS.getCode(), msg); } public static ResponseData buildSuccess(String code, String msg) { return new ResponseData(code, msg); } public static ResponseData buildSuccess(String code, String msg, T data) { return new ResponseData (code, msg, data); } public static ResponseData buildSuccess(ResultEnums resultEnums) { return new ResponseData(resultEnums); } public static ResponseData buildError(T data) { return new ResponseData (ResultEnums.ERROR, data); } public static ResponseData buildError() { return new ResponseData(ResultEnums.ERROR); } public static ResponseData buildError(String msg) { return new ResponseData(ResultEnums.ERROR.getCode(), msg); } public static ResponseData buildError(String code, String msg) { return new ResponseData(code, msg); } public static ResponseData buildError(String code, String msg, T data) { return new ResponseData (code, msg, data); } public static ResponseData buildError(ResultEnums resultEnums) { return new ResponseData(resultEnums); }}
ResultEnum
public enum ResultEnums { SUCCESS("0000", "请求成功"), ERROR("1111", "请求失败"), SYSTEM_ERROR("1000", "系统异常"), BUSSINESS_ERROR("2001", "业务逻辑错误"), VERIFY_CODE_ERROR("2002", "业务参数错误"), PARAM_ERROR("2002", "业务参数错误"); private String code; private String msg; ResultEnums(String code, String msg) { this.code = code; this.msg = msg; } public String getCode() { return code; } public void setCode(String code) { this.code = code; } public String getMsg() { return msg; } public void setMsg(String msg) { this.msg = msg; }}
